在Linux系统中搭建安全的数据库环境,首先要选择合适的数据库软件,如MySQL、PostgreSQL或MariaDB。这些数据库通常提供丰富的安全功能,并且有活跃的社区支持,能够及时修复漏洞。
安装完成后,应立即配置强密码策略,限制远程访问权限,并关闭不必要的服务和端口。使用防火墙工具如iptables或ufw来控制入站和出站流量,可以有效防止未授权的访问。

AI生成3D模型,仅供参考
数据库用户的权限管理至关重要。应遵循最小权限原则,为每个用户分配必要的权限,避免使用root账户进行日常操作。定期审核用户权限,确保没有多余或过期的账户。
数据备份是防护策略的重要组成部分。建议定期执行全量和增量备份,并将备份文件存储在安全的位置,最好采用加密方式保护数据。同时,测试恢复流程,确保在发生故障时能快速恢复。
日志监控和入侵检测也是保障数据库安全的关键措施。启用数据库日志记录,并定期检查日志文件,有助于发现异常行为。结合入侵检测系统(IDS)或安全信息与事件管理(SIEM)工具,可以提升整体安全防护能力。